The cartridge structure allows the valve to become part of a larger fluid-control assembly rather than functioning only as an external standalone unit. This can simplify internal routing and support compact equipment design, but it also creates stricter requirements for the receiving cavity, insertion interface, sealing surfaces, and alignment between the valve and surrounding components.

Dimensional accuracy is therefore fundamental. The valve body and corresponding installation cavity must maintain appropriate relationships during assembly. CNC machining can provide controlled dimensions for cylindrical surfaces, grooves, passages, and other interfaces. Consistent machining helps ensure that the component can be installed correctly and that the sealing structure maintains the intended relationship with the surrounding housing.

Material selection influences both the valve itself and the equipment into which it is installed. Internal areas may contact water, while external surfaces can experience humidity, cleaning agents, mechanical stress, and temperature changes. Corrosion-resistant metals can provide structural strength, while engineering polymers may offer electrical insulation and dimensional stability. Material compatibility at the cartridge interface should also be evaluated carefully.

The electromagnetic actuator needs to operate within a compact structure without compromising movement. The coil, magnetic core, movable element, spring, and housing must be arranged so that magnetic force can be converted into predictable mechanical action. In an embedded configuration, surrounding materials can influence the magnetic circuit, making system-level design especially important.

Fluid-path engineering is another major consideration. The internal passage must connect correctly with the larger hydraulic structure while maintaining controlled water movement. Designers should examine transitions, valve seats, openings, and mating surfaces as part of a complete flow route. Precision manufacturing helps reduce unwanted dimensional variation and supports consistent fluid-control behavior.

Sealing is particularly important because cartridge components often rely on closely fitted interfaces within a receiving cavity. Sealing elements need to maintain an effective barrier between the fluid pathway and surrounding areas. Their material should be compatible with water and the expected operating environment, while groove geometry and surface finish need to support stable positioning during assembly.

The compact architecture also affects maintenance planning. Engineers may need to consider how the component can be installed, inspected, or replaced within the finished equipment. A carefully designed interface can simplify assembly and reduce unnecessary complexity during production. For OEM manufacturers, this can be an important factor when developing appliances intended for efficient large-scale manufacturing.

Electronic control can further expand the applications of embedded electromagnetic valves. Sensors can detect user interaction or system conditions, while control boards process those signals and determine when fluid movement is required. The embedded actuator then provides the mechanical response. This arrangement allows manufacturers to combine sensing, processing, and water management within a compact product architecture.

Electrical protection remains essential because the component is installed within equipment that may handle water. Coil insulation, wiring connections, housing interfaces, and moisture-resistant structures should be considered together. Production testing can help verify electrical assembly quality, while controlled installation procedures reduce the risk of damage to sensitive components during integration.

Manufacturing automation can improve repeatability for compact assemblies. Automated equipment can assist with seal placement, component insertion, coil installation, and final assembly. Vision systems can check positioning, while dimensional inspection can verify critical interfaces. Leakage testing and functional testing can then evaluate the completed assembly under controlled conditions.
